How I explain therapy vs medications to patients
I tell patients that therapy and medication can work hand in hand but serve different purposes. Therapy helps uncover patterns, build coping skills, and address root causes of distress. Medication, on the other hand, can stabilize symptoms like anxiety or depression to make therapy more effective.

get to know me I’m a Cancer Registrar
I’m a cancer registrar. We collect cancer incidence on patients and survivors to include history, diagnosis, treatment, staging, prognostics indicators and and outcomes which assist with monitoring cancer control, morbidity and prevention and screening initiatives. #HelloLemon8 #gettoknowme
